Union Value Discovery Fund Direct Plan Growth, managed by Union Mutual Fund, is a value fund that aims to identify undervalued stocks across market capitalisations. The fund employs a value investing strategy, focusing on companies with strong fundamentals and growth potential that are trading at a discount to their intrinsic value. The fund has an expense ratio that is higher than the category average.
Investment Objective of the Scheme
The main objective of Union Value Discovery Fund Direct Plan Growth is to achieve long-term capital appreciation by investing in a diversified portfolio of stocks that are deemed undervalued by the fund's investment team. The fund managers conduct in-depth research to select stocks that offer growth prospects and are available at attractive valuations.

What is today's NAV of Union Value Fund?
NAV, or Net Asset Value, is the price of a single unit of a mutual fund. It is calculated by dividing the current value of holdings held by the mutual fund scheme at the end of the day by the total number of units issued. The NAV changes every day. The NAV of Union Value Fund on August 30, 2026, is ₹31.25
What is the AUM of Union Value Fund?
Short for Asset Under Management, AUM means the total assets held by a mutual fund scheme. The AUM of the fund changes every day based on the fluctuation in the price of the underlying assets. Fund houses don't update AUM on a daily basis. They only update it at the end of the month and release it within a few days of the following month. The AUM of Union Value Fund, is ₹395.49 crore.
What is the expense ratio of Union Value Fund?
The expense ratio is the annual charges you pay to the mutual fund house for managing your investments. It is a percentage of Assets Under Management. It is deducted from the fund's returns. The expense ratio of Union Value Fund is 1.54%
